Property Development Senior Manager Salary in the United States

How much does a Property Development Senior Manager make in the United States?

As of July 01, 2026, the average salary for a Property Development Senior Manager in the United States is $147,860 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$71.

However, a Property Development Senior Manager's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$174,320
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$131,400 to $161,710
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$116,414

Property Development Senior Manager Salary by Company Size: Startups vs. Enterprise

Property Development Senior Manager salary potential scales significantly with company size. Data shows that Enterprise companies (5,000+ employees) pay the highest average salary at around $165,380. While startup companies pay approximate $139,862.

Property Development Senior Manager Salary by Industry: Top Paying Sectors

For Property Development Senior Manager roles, the industry you choose can affect earning potential by as much as 45% (the gap between the highest and lowest paying industries). Data shows that the Financial Services and Internet sectors offer the strongest compensation, at 20% above the average. In contrast, Property Development Senior Manager positions in Hospitality & Leisure or Edu., Gov't. & Nonprofit typically offer lower base pay, as these industries often view Property Development Senior Manager as a support function rather than a direct revenue driver.

Property Development Senior Manager Salary Growth & Career Path

For a Property Development Senior Manager, the most direct path to higher earnings is advancing to the Construction and Building Project Director role. This promotion typically comes with a significant pay increase, bringing the average annual salary to $203,400 - a projected growth of 38% over your current level.
